QUNU (IMO 9755218, MMSI 601242800) is a Tug flagged in South Africa. QUNU was built in 2016 with a deadweight capacity of 260 MT and a length overall of 30 metres. The vessel was last recorded travelling at 0.1 knots, with a next recorded destination of PORT ELIZABETH port (ZAPLZ).
